Vinay Somaiah Death: They Ruined My Life, Suicide Note Of Kodagu Man Alleges Political Vendetta

A 35-year-old man was found dead by suicide in his office in Bengaluru's Nagawara area on Friday. In a letter, he alleged that a politically motivated FIR, orchestrated by a local Congress leader, forced him to die by suicide. The man, identified as BJP functionary Vinay Somaiah, accused Congress functionary Thennira Mahina MLA AS Ponnanna, and others of harassment and false implication in a case.

Vinay Somaiah Suicide I Was Made a Scapegoat Suicide Note Of BJP Worker Alleges Political Vendetta

Vinay, a native of Somwarpet in Karnataka's Kodagu district, was an administrator of the WhatsApp group "Kodagina Samasyegalu," where a controversial post against Congress MLA and legal advisor to Karnataka Chief Minister Siddaramaiah, AS Ponnanna, had been shared. The post contained an edited image of Ponnanna in traditional Kodava attire alongside a toilet, accompanied by derogatory text.

Vinay stated that a message forwarded in the group led to an FIR being filed against him. The complaint, he said, portrayed him and others as 'anti-social elements,' causing massive social distress.

"I was made the admin just five days before the message was posted, but I was unfairly held responsible. Due to political hatred, people like Thennira Mahina have played with my life," he wrote. "He was the one who circulated our photos without permission, calling us rowdies and maligning our image across Kodagu."

Vinay accused Maheena of being directly responsible for his death and also hinted at Maheena's alleged involvement in another suicide case, demanding an investigation into that incident as well.

He added that even after receiving bail, Madikeri police continued to harass his relatives and friends. He alleged that the police visited his cousin's house the very next day, seeking to arrest him despite court relief.

''It is true that I sent a message-but I had only forwarded a voice message that someone else sent me, to inform him of the matter. I even shared the screenshot. But instead of filing an FIR for that, they filed one against us based on some photo someone shared. How is that justice?

''When I inquired in a group about the Kushalnagar Government Hospital, Madikeri MLA Mantar Gowda called me and scolded me for posting such messages in the group. He said, "Why post this in the group? If you need anything, tell me directly," he wrote, adding that he had provided WhatsApp call logs and screenshots as evidence.

Vinay pleaded with Karnataka BJP leaders and workers to support his family-his mother, wife, and daughter-both emotionally and financially.

"Even if each person contributes a rupee, it will help secure my wife and daughter's future," he wrote. "I humbly request that no one apply for leave and travel to attend my funeral. Just bless my family from wherever you are."

He requested that his close friends Chalan, Vishnu, and Sachin stand with his family and ensure that all funeral rituals proceed smoothly.

Vinay concluded his message by expressing his emotional turmoil and helplessness.

"For two months, my mind has been out of control. This FIR and the public humiliation shattered me. Let my death serve as a lesson against politically motivated FIRs. Let innocent lives not be ruined this way again," he wrote.

He ended with a final farewell: "To everyone, my final namaste. I'm going with all your blessings. Please forgive me if possible."

His death has triggered shock and calls for accountability in Kodagu, with several demanding a fair investigation into his claims of political harassment and the abuse of law enforcement for personal vendettas.
